Over 4,500 students from 100 Iowa schools participated in the annual Build My Future event at the Iowa State Fairgrounds, which included hands-on learning and career exploration of skilled trades.
Students from across the state connected with business and industry in 115 hands-on activities. During the event, attendees tried out the latest equipment and technology used in skilled trades. Work-based learning activities like this can help students explore their options and find their career pathway.
Iowa Department of Education Director Ann Lebo and Teacher of the Year George Anderson joined in the activities. As a part of Signing Day, Governor Reynolds met with students and business leaders during the event and also participated in the work-based learning activities.
